我使用的是 Audient id44 数字音频接口,通过 USB 连接。我看到输出中有失真(缺少样本)。为了调试它,我以 CD 分辨率(带aplay
)输出数字生成的正弦波,并在示波器上查看输出信号。音频接口适用于工作室工作,Ubuntu 是 Ubuntu Studio 18.04,应该针对延迟等进行了优化。
我的问题是:这看起来像是一个错误还是看起来像是配置错误?
输出为 440 Hz 正弦波,其周期为 2.27 ms,我们发现缺少了大约 0.62 ms。
环境
- Ubuntu 工作室https://ubuntustudio.org/tour/audio/
- Ubuntu 18.04.4,刚刚重启
- Ubuntu Studio 说它不是 LTShttps://ubuntustudio.org/2019/04/ubuntu-studio-18-04-extended-support/
- 尽管如此,文件仍被标记为 LTS
/.disk/info
说Ubuntu-Studio 18.04 LTS "Bionic Beaver" - Release i386 (20180426)
和/etc/os_release
说PRETTY_NAME="Ubuntu 18.04.4 LTS"
- 内核版本:4.15.0-111-lowlatency
- 架构:i686
- 计算机:Intel DG43GT 主板,8 GB RAM
- CPU:Intel(R) Core(TM)2 Duo CPU E7600 @ 3.06GHz(系列:0x6,型号:0x17,步进:0xa)
- ALSA 驱动程序版本:k4.15.0-111-lowlatency
- ALSA 库版本:1.1.3
- ALSA 声卡描述 USB-Audio - Audient iD44,Audient Audient iD44 位于 usb-0000:00:1a.7-6,高速
排除的事情
- 这不是特定的 id44:将相同的硬件插入 Windows 10 Dell 780 计算机不会发生此错误
- 这不是音频文件:尝试了许多不同的音频文件。
- 这不是输出速率:尝试过 44.1 kHz、48 kHz 等等。
- 这不是模拟方面:无法解释范围图像。
- 这不是 USB 插座:使用哪个 USB 端口都没有区别。
- 它不是更高级的音频程序:无论你使用 aplay、VLC 还是 ardour 都没有区别
- 不是这台电脑的问题:这个错误确实出现在一台原装的 Ubuntu 18.04 笔记本电脑上